Ladies and gentleman, there is a Twitter account I'd like you all to meet: @horse_ebooks. On its surface, it's nothing special -- just a Russian-owned Twitter spam account designed to sell (predictably) ebooks about horses. To appear as if it were a human, the account employs a comically bad algorithm that tweets seemingly random sentences fragments.

If @horse_ebooks is an attempt to pass a Turing test, it fails on every level. Little it says seems relevant to horses; nothing it says seems to make sense. It's short dispatches are internet-age poetry at its finest -- absurd works of art, all. It's my inspiration.
